What Information is Included in the Diocese of Green Bay Directory?
The directory provides a wealth of information, generally including:
- Parish Information: This is the core of the directory, listing all parishes within the diocese. Each entry typically includes the parish's address, phone number, email address, website, Mass schedule, priest's name, and sometimes even a brief history or description of the parish.
- Schools: Catholic schools within the diocese will also be listed, providing contact information and potentially details on enrollment, programs, and school events.
- Diocesan Offices: The directory will feature a comprehensive list of diocesan offices, providing contact details for various departments, such as the Office of the Bishop, the Office of Faith Formation, and the Office of Social Justice.
- Ministries and Services: Many dioceses list details about various ministries and services available within their purview, including those related to youth, families, social services, and more.
